Essential Gear for Riders

Safety should always be a top priority for motorcyclists. Investing in high-quality gear can protect you from potential injuries and enhance your riding experience. Essential gear includes a DOT-approved helmet, gloves, jacket, pants, and boots. Additionally, consider adding protective eyewear and reflective clothing to increase visibility on the road.

Aside from safety gear, having the right tools and accessories can make your rides more enjoyable. Items like saddlebags, phone mounts, and GPS devices can add convenience and comfort to your journeys. Don’t forget to pack essentials like a first-aid kit, water, and snacks for longer rides.

Mastering the Basics

Before hitting the open road, it’s crucial to master the basics of motorcycling. Familiarize yourself with the controls, practice starting, stopping, and turning in a safe environment, and learn how to handle different road conditions. Taking a motorcycle safety course can provide valuable knowledge and skills to help you become a confident and responsible rider.

As you gain experience, challenge yourself with advanced techniques like cornering, braking, and swerving. These skills can help you navigate challenging situations and improve your overall riding abilities. Always remember that practice and patience are key to becoming a proficient motorcyclist.

Maintaining Your Motorcycle

Regular maintenance is crucial to keeping your motorcycle in optimal condition. Follow the manufacturer’s recommended service schedule, and perform routine checks on tires, brakes, fluids, and lights. Keeping your bike clean and well-maintained not only enhances its performance but also extends its lifespan.

Learning basic maintenance tasks like changing oil, checking tire pressure, and replacing brake pads can save you time and money. Investing in quality tools and accessories can make these tasks easier and more enjoyable. Always refer to your motorcycle’s manual for specific instructions and guidelines.
